Graduated as a Telecommunications Engineer from the E.T.S.I. Telecomunicación in Madrid.
Fraile Mora’s teaching career is inextricably linked to the top engineering schools in Spain. As infrastructure ages, it transitions from functional utility to cultural heritage. Fraile Mora has been a vocal advocate for the conservation of the history of public works.
